The facts: Guantanamo Bay, Cuba - Gitmo as it is known - based marines Lance
Corporal Harold Dawson and Private Louden Downey assaulted Private William
Santiago in the middle of the night, which included stuffing a rag into his
mouth, Santiago who died shortly thereafter of respiratory complications.
Special Judge Advocate Counsel Lieutenant Joanne Galloway believes Dawson and
Downey were just following orders, as part of the marine's unofficial "code red"
where there is self policing within the ranks, and that there was no intent of
murder. Galloway, a naive lawyer who seeks fairness and justice at all cost,
wants to be assigned the case but she has no trial experience. Instead, the
military assigns Lieutenant Daniel Kaffee to be Dawson and Downey's counsel.
Kaffee is a lightweight lawyer who also has no trial experience and has a
history of taking, as Galloway refers, the path of least resistance by plea
bargaining regardless of his clients' guilt/innocence and their wants. Galloway
becomes co-counsel in the case. The two, with their assistant Lieutenant Sam
Weinberg, have to decide what to do, not an easy task considering their
differing views on law and what is best for all including themselves. They do
believe Dawson and Downey's story that they were following unofficial/official
code red orders, but are uncertain if their case is winnable, especially against
the marine machine run by Gitmo's Colonel Nathan Jessep.
